Adjust an oven rack to the middle position and preheat the oven to 325F.
Toast the peanuts in a 12 inch skillet over medium heat, stirring constantly, for 2-3 minutes until the peanuts are a light brown and smell fragrant.
Stir in the oats and oil and continue to toast until the oats are a light golden brown (about 2 minutes).
Remove from the heat and then stir in honey, peanut butter, and salt until oats are well coated.
Spread oats on a baking sheet in an even layer.
Bake in the oven at 324F for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the oats are a nice golden brown.
Remove from the oven and stir the granola, clumping it together.
Let the granola cool to room temperature, about 30 minutes.
Loosen the dried granola with a spatula, break into small clusters, and serve.
You can store granola in an air tight container for up to a week.
